## Deploy Step 4: Bigdiff Viewer

This step rolls out Bigdiff, the viewer customers use to compare large export files. Support should know: deploys happen per-region, starting with Ostmere, and take roughly ten minutes each. During rollout, users may briefly see the old chunked view — that's expected, not a bug. Don't restart the viewer pods manually; the orchestrator handles drain and swap. The rollout bundle must be verified against the current deploy key, which is listed below for reference.

release key, hadug-kawef: bky13_mPGeFZeR1GZ1G

Hey — handing off the Quillhopper migration. We're finally killing the homegrown job queue (old `taskbarn` daemon) in favor of Strelvane Queue. Dual-writes are on; the drain script is `scripts/drain_taskbarn.sh`. If jobs pile up overnight, just pause the old consumer, don't kill it, or you'll orphan leases. The drain script asks for the ops recovery passphrase before it'll touch production leases, so here it is.

strongbox words: fraath-isteth

The Orvane Labs bike cage and the east and west parking gates operate on separate access schedules, and facilities desk staff should note that visitor vehicles may only use the west gate between 07:00 and 19:00. Cyclists requesting cage access must show a valid day pass, and their details should be entered in the access ledger before the cage is opened. Gates must never be propped open, even briefly, during deliveries. When a manual override is required at either gate, use the code below.

staff pass of fadup-fawig = bdg-FUNKS-4

**Mgmt Meeting Minutes — Retiring the Brightline Range**

Quick recap for sales leads at Fenholt Supplies: we agreed to retire the Brightline fixture range by year-end. Remaining stock moves to clearance pricing next month, and accounts on standing orders get migrated to the Lumetta range. Trade-in incentives were approved in principle. The confidential note on next steps sits just below.

board note of bajof-bajeg: The pricing group signed off on a budget of $13.4 million for Project Sildor. The renewal with Lamixek Holdings closes at $48.9 million a year, 49 percent above the last contract.